Information About Mercedes Brand

Mercedes-Benz is a Subsidiary type automotive industry in Germany. It is a subsidiary type car brand which was founded on 28 June 1926. Benz & Cie (1883–1926), Daimler-Motoren-Gesellschaft (1890–1926), and Mercedes (marque) (1901–1926) were the Predecessors of this company. For producing luxury vehicles and commercial vehicles, Mercedes-Benz is well known to the whole world. The headquarters of this brand is in Stuttgart, Baden-Württemberg. After selling 2.31 million passenger cars, Mercedes-Benz became the largest seller of premium vehicles in the world. The founders of this brand are Karl Benz and Gottlieb Daimler. Mercedes-Benz E-Class

Mercedes-Benz E-Class

Mercedes-Benz E-Class is a middle-range luxurious product of the Mercedes lineup from 1993 to the present, and it has been marketed five generations across the world. Daimler-Benz (1993–1998), DaimlerChrysler (1998–2007), Daimler AG (2007–present), Magna Steyr (4MATIC models only, 1996–2009) are the main manufacturer of Mercedes Benz E-class. Mercedes sold more than 13 million models by 2015, and the E-Class is the best selling model of Mercedes Benz and so popular to the car lover people. In 2015, the Mercedes brand sold more than 13 million Mercedes-Benz E-Class models.  There are 5 generations available on the market. Here I mention these 5 generations below. 

First-generation (W124; 1993–1995)

In 1994, with the facelifted W124, the “E-Class” name first appeared. This first-generation came with gasoline V8 engines and over the four and six-cylinder gasoline engines that further increased gasoline power outputs. From 1992–1993, the V8 powered sedans/saloons were named 400 E/500 E and E 420/E 500 after 1993. With the new 3.2-liter M104 engines and naming rationalization of 1994, the 3.0-liter cars (e.g., 300 E) were also re-badged to E 320.

W124 E-Class

Second-generation (W210; 1996–2002)

The second generation of E-class had come with the mid-luxury W210 E-Class launched in 1995 and facelifted in September 1999. Compared to the earlier version of the E-class, the E-class made many major changes, including four large oval headlights starting in 1996. However, the new E-class is considered mid-size. That new generation was 1.6 inches longer and 2.3 inches wider and offered significantly more interior room.

 

W210 E-Class

Third-generation (W211; 2003–2009)

The third generation of Mercedes Benz E-class came with the W211 E-Class launching in 2002. This model was another evolution of the previous model of the E-class line-up. In 2005, the W211 was introduced as a niche model based on the C219 CLS-Class sedan. For addressing quality and technical issues, the W211 E-Class was facelifted in June 2006 for the 2007 model year raised by the earlier models.

W211 E-Class

Fourth-generation (2010-2016)

In 2010, the W212 came in the place of the W211 as a 2010 model. Mercedes Benz leaked the official photos of the W212 on the internet on 9 December 2008. Blindspot monitor, Lane Keeping Assist, Pre-safe with Attention Assist and Night View Assist Plus were the new features included in this new model. However, it priced nearly US$4,600 less than the previous model in the United States. The coupé (C207) was another evolution in the Mercedes Benz E-class lineup included in the fourth generation that was first shown at the 2009 Geneva Motor Show. These two models took place in the previous C209/A209 CLK-Class models.

W212 E-Class

Fifth-generation (W213; 2017–present)

Finally, we came to the last generation named the fifth generation of E-class with W213 E-Class model that was unveiled at the NAIAS (North American International Auto Show) in 2016. There had a major update in the engine segment of W213 E-class for a switch to inline-6 engines from the current V6 engines. After the new S Class, this is the model, which is the second most technologically advanced Mercedes. W213 E-class can pilot itself up to 130 mph, which is 210 Kmph, for up to 2 minutes. To the W213, Mercedes-Benz introduced a facelift in 2020.

Mercedes-Benz E-Class Fifth-Generation Full Specifications

Mercedes Benz E-Class Fifth-generation W213 E-class has a V-type Biturbo petrol Eng engine with 3982 CCs. This engine can make a maximum of 603.46bhp@5750-6500rpm power and 850Nm@2500-4500rpm torque. This car’s top speed is 250 Km per hour, and it burns 1 liter of petrol after running of 10.98 Km. This model also has the Antilock Braking System feature. Driver airbags and passenger airbags are also included for making the best safety for the driver and passengers. Expression, Exclusive and Elite; Mercedes Benz E-Class is available on the market in these three variants. Word and Exclusive can be had with a petrol or diesel engine, and Elite can be had with only the diesel engine. There are also have many other specifications that I listed below.

Engine Type: V Type Biturbo Petrol Eng
Displacement (cc): 3982
Top Speed (Kmph): 250
Max Power: 603.46bhp@5750-6500rpm
Max Torque:  850Nm@2500-4500rpm
Body Type: Sedan
No. of cylinder: 8
Valves Per Cylinder: 4
Fuel Type: Petrol
Fuel Tank Capacity (liters): 66
Fuel Supply System: Direct Injection
ARAI Mileage (Kmpl): 10.98
Weight (Kg): 1990
TransmissionType: Automatic
Gear Box: 9 Speed
